Jieh-Yung Lo

Director, Centre for Asian-Australian Leadership (CAAL), The Australian National University

Jieh-Yung Lo is the founding Director of the Centre for Asian-Australian Leadership (CAAL) at the Australian National University (ANU), leading efforts to promote Asian-Australian representation in leadership roles across public and private sectors in Australia.

With a background as an executive officer to Professor the Hon Gareth Evans AC QC, Chancellor of ANU, Jieh-Yung was instrumental in establishing the ANU's Melbourne engagement and outreach strategy, and spearheaded the Asian-Australian Leadership Summit (AALS) to boost diversity leadership nationally.

Prior to his current role, Jieh-Yung held policy and project positions in non-profit and advocacy organizations and served as a Councillor, including a term as Deputy Mayor, with the City of Monash.

Jieh-Yung Lo pursued his Bachelor of Arts (BA) degree at the University of Melbourne, cultivating a solid foundation for his subsequent career in leadership and advocacy.
